Coronavirus: KWASU closes till further notice

Date: 2020-03-21

Dear All,

This is to inform the entire University Community (both staff and students) that as part of measures to prevent the spread of the Corona virus (COVID - 19) in the country, the Federal Government through the National Universities Commission (NUC) has directed Vice-Chancellors of Nigerian Universities to close their Institutions for one month with effect from Monday 23rd March, 2020.

Consequently, the acting Vice-Chancellor on behalf of Senate of this University, has approved the closure of the University until further notice.

All members of staff and students are hereby implored to continue to observe high personal hygiene and also abide by all other preventive measures as announced by the relevant agencies of Government.
